    Vietnam has 3 distinct regions each with its own dialect and customs, they are the South with Saigon as its capital, Central with Hue as its historical capital and the North with Hanoi as the country's capital.

    Prior to 1975 the country was divided into two halves by the 17th parallel at the de-militarized zone.
